Comprehending the 4-Door Design
The 4-door American fridge freezer, often described as a "Multidoor" or "Cross Door" refrigerator, normally features 2 side-by-side doors for the refrigerator section on the top and 2 doors (or occasionally drawers) for the freezer section on the bottom. Unlike a conventional side-by-side design, which is split vertically from leading to bottom, the 4-door design permits a full-width fridge compartment.

This configuration is engineered to decrease "cold air loss." By opening only one of the four doors at a time, users ensure that a significant portion of the internal temperature level stays steady, thus enhancing energy effectiveness and food conservation.
Key Features and Technological Innovations1. Flexible Storage Zones
Possibly the most considerable innovation in 4-door models is the "Flex Zone." Lots of superior producers develop the lower right-hand compartment to be switchable. Depending upon the user's needs, this area can operate as a freezer, a soft-freeze zone for meats, or a basic fridge area. This adaptability is invaluable during vacation seasons or big household events when extra fridge area is required for platters and drinks.
2. Advanced Cooling Systems
Modern 4-door units frequently use "Triple Cooling" or "Twin Cooling" innovation. This includes separate evaporators and fans for the fridge and freezer sections. By isolating the airflow, the home appliance prevents the transfer of odors in between the fish in the freezer and the butter in the fridge. Moreover, it keeps optimum humidity levels in the refrigerator area, which keeps vegetables and fruits crisp for longer durations.
3. Integrated Water and Ice Dispensers
Many American-style models come geared up with external dispensers. These offer crushed ice, cubed ice, and cooled, filtered water at the touch of a button. While some designs need a direct pipes connection, many now offer "non-plumbed" variations with internal water tanks, offering more flexibility regarding where the system can be positioned in the kitchen.

Dimensions and Clearance
These units are significantly bigger than basic refrigerators.
Width: Usually in between 85cm and 95cm.Depth: Often 70cm or deeper. It is essential to measure the depth of the kitchen area counters and ensure there suffices "depth clearance" for the doors to swing open completely.Access Route: One need to determine the width of the front door, hallways, and cooking area entranceways to make sure the unit can really be delivered into the room.Pipes Requirements
If going with a design with an ice and water dispenser, one should choose between plumbed and non-plumbed.
Plumbed: Requires a water connection within 1.5 to 2 meters of the system. This offers a constant supply of ice and water without refills.Non-Plumbed: Features an internal tank (usually 3-- [4 Door American Fridge Freezer](https://my-social-box.com/story6235187/11-ways-to-completely-revamp-your-american-fridge-freezer-uk) liters). This is easier to set up but requires manual refilling.Energy Ratings
Under the brand-new post-2021 energy labeling system (A-G), lots of large [American Style Fridges](https://americanfridgefreezers42005.blogtov.com/21220739/american-style-fridge-freezer-tools-to-facilitate-your-everyday-life) fridge freezers fall into the E or F categories. While this might seem low, it is necessary to bear in mind that these scores are relative to the system's size. For a more precise budget forecast, purchasers ought to take a look at the "kWh per annum" figure to approximate yearly running costs.
Sound Levels
For open-plan living spaces, the sound level is a crucial element. A lot of modern-day 4-door systems run in between 35dB and 42dB. Models with "Inverter Compressors" tend to be quieter and more long lasting as they adjust their speed based on cooling need rather than changing on and off suddenly.
Maintenance for Longevity
To ensure a 4-door [American Fridge Freezer Reviews](https://american-freezer74572.blogofchange.com/41174450/a-time-travelling-journey-how-people-talked-about-american-fridge-freezer-20-years-ago) fridge freezer operates at peak performance for its expected 10-- 15 year lifespan, routine maintenance is needed:
Vacuum the Coils: Dust accumulation on the condenser coils at the back or bottom of the system can trigger the compressor to get too hot. Clean these every six months.Replace Water Filters: For plumbed designs, filters need to usually be replaced every six months to guarantee water pureness and prevent limescale buildup in the dispenser mechanisms.Inspect Door Seals: Periodically wipe the magnetic door seals with a wet cloth. A clean seal ensures an airtight fit, avoiding energy waste.Leveling: Use a level throughout installation. Q: Are 4-door fridge freezers more costly to run than basic models?A: Due to their larger size, they generally take in more overall electrical energy than a basic 60cm fridge freezer. Nevertheless, because you only open little sections of the system at a time, they are typically more efficient than older, traditional American side-by-side models.

Q: Can I fit a 4-door fridge freezer into a standard kitchen area cabinet gap?A: Usually, no. Requirement UK/European cooking area gaps are 60cm broad. 4-door American models generally need a 90cm to 100cm space. They are normally created to be freestanding or integrated into a customized kitchen "housing."

Q: What is a "Total No [Frost Free American Fridge Freezer](https://americanfridge02063.wikikarts.com/2178464/20_resources_to_help_you_become_better_at_american_fridge)" feature?A: This technology uses fans to continuously flow cold air, preventing wetness from settling and becoming ice. It suggests the user will never ever need to manually defrost the freezer, and food products won't stick together.

Q: Is the "Flex Zone" actually helpful?A: Yes. It supplies the ability to change the function of a compartment based on seasonal requirements. For example, it can be set to 0 ° C to keep beverages additional cold for a summer season celebration, or -18 ° C for extra frozen storage throughout a bulk grocery store.
